What to Bring to Your First NA Meeting in Thorsby

You don't need to bring anything to an NA meeting in Thorsby, Alabama except yourself and a willingness to listen. There's no fee, no paperwork, and no sign-in sheet. If you'd like, you can bring a notebook to jot down phone numbers or things that resonate with you.

Many newcomers in Thorsby find it helpful to arrive with an open mind. You may hear ideas that are new or unfamiliar, and that's okay. Take what helps and leave the rest, as members often say.

If you're feeling anxious, consider bringing a trusted friend to an open meeting. Above all, remember that everyone in the room once attended a first meeting too, and they remember how it felt to walk in for the first time.

Can family members attend NA meetings in Thorsby, Alabama?

Yes, loved ones are welcome at open meetings in Thorsby, Alabama. Families seeking their own support often also attend Nar-Anon, a related fellowship for relatives and friends of addicts, available throughout the Chilton area.

How do I find a sponsor in Thorsby, Alabama?

Keep coming back to meetings in Thorsby, Alabama and the Chilton area and get to know members. When someone's experience resonates with you, ask them to be your sponsor. Members are usually glad to help a newcomer.

How does sponsorship work for newcomers in Thorsby, Alabama?

A sponsor is a recovering addict who has worked the Twelve Steps and guides newer members through the same process. In Thorsby, Alabama, a sponsor offers one-on-one support, shares their experience, and helps you navigate the challenges of early recovery.

How many NA meetings should a newcomer in Thorsby, Alabama attend?

There is no required attendance, but many recovering addicts suggest 90 meetings in 90 days when starting out. Attending meetings in Thorsby, Alabama regularly helps build connections and reinforces your commitment to staying clean.

What happens if I relapse and come back to a Thorsby, Alabama meeting?

Come back to meetings. Many recovering addicts have experienced relapse, and the fellowship in Thorsby, Alabama welcomes anyone who returns with a desire to stay clean. You will not be judged or shamed for coming back.
